Kingdom Hearts

Kingdom Hearts is an action role-playing game developed and published by Squaresoft (now Square Enix) in 2002 for the PlayStation 2 video game console. It is the result of a collaboration between Square and The Walt Disney Company. The game combines characters and settings from Disney's animated features with those from the Final Fantasy series, developed by Square. The story follows Sora, a young boy, as he is thrown into an epic battle against the darkness. He is joined by Donald Duck and Goofy, classic Disney characters, who help him on his quest.
Kingdom Hearts was a departure from Square's standard role-playing games by introducing a substantial action-adventure element. In addition, it had an all-star voice cast which included many of the Disney characters' official voice actors. Kingdom Hearts was longtime Square character designer Tetsuya Nomura's first time in a directorial position.
The game was praised for its unusual combination of action and role-playing, as well as its unexpectedly harmonious mix of Square and Disney. It received numerous year-end "Best" video game awards and was a dominating presence in the 2002 holiday season and went on to achieve Sony "Greatest Hits" status. Since its release, Kingdom Hearts has sold over 5.6 million copies worldwide and has been followed by two sequels.Three more titles are currently being developed, which have a connection to a future, unannounced game.

Characters
Sora - The primary protagonist of the Kingdom Hearts series, and the character that the player has direct control over throughout almost the entire series. He is an original character created by Tetsuya Nomura for the Kingdom Hearts series. Sora's weapon is the Keyblade. Though not the original wielder of the Keyblade, Sora was chosen over Riku because Sora chose light, while Riku opened himself to darkness.
At the beginning of the series, Sora is 14 years old and lives on Destiny Islands along with his two friends, Riku and Kairi. When their world is attacked by a group of corrupted hearts known as the Heartless, the three are separated. During the invasion, he obtains the Keyblade. Soon after, Sora meets Donald Duck and Goofy, who join him on his search for his friends. To blend in with the inhabitants of the various worlds they visit, the group's appearances are altered by either Donald's magic or, in Kingdom Hearts II, by Sora's magical clothes. Some examples include a dolphin-like merman and a brown lion cub.
Riku: Sora and Kairi's best friend and an original character created by Tetsuya Nomura for the Kingdom Hearts series. He was originally meant to be the true keyblade master, but when he submitted himself to darkness, his heart was not strong enough to wield the keyblade, and thus it chose Sora as its wielder.
At the beginning of the series, he is 15 years old and lives on Destiny Islands with his friends. When their world is attacked by the Heartless, the three are separated. Riku ends up at Hollow Bastion where he is found by Maleficent. Under her influence, he becomes an antagonist to help Kairi.
Upon learning to channel the darkness within him, he forged it into a sword, the Soul Eater. This later becomes the Way to the Dawn keyblade. He also wielded the Dark Keyblade, a unique keyblade able to unlock people's hearts and amplify the darkness within them.
Kairi: One of three original characters appearing in Kingdom Hearts and Kingdom Hearts II. Kairi lives on Destiny Islands along with her companions, Sora and Riku, although it is established early on that she is not a native of them. She is 14 at the start of Kingdom Hearts. She bears no memory of her life before the Islands, and Kairi's mysterious past sparks curiosity in Sora and Riku, who are anxious to leave Destiny Islands and see other worlds. This leads the trio to build a raft in the hopes of traveling to other worlds. However, before they can leave, their Islands are attacked by the Heartless, and the three are split up. She then becomes the game's driving force, as much of the game's story centers around Sora's and Riku's attempts at finding Kairi.
